views
Running payroll is one of the most important responsibilities for any business. Whether you're a small startup or a growing company, ensuring employees are paid accurately and on time is critical. That’s where payroll software comes in. It simplifies the entire process, saving time, reducing errors, and helping businesses stay compliant with legal requirements.
In this article, we’ll explore what payroll software is, how it works, and why it’s essential for modern businesses.
What Is Payroll Software?
Payroll software is a digital tool designed to manage all aspects of employee compensation. It automates the process of calculating wages, deducting taxes, issuing payments, and generating payslips. Most payroll systems also handle compliance with tax regulations and government reporting requirements.
This type of software is used by HR teams, finance departments, business owners, and accountants to streamline payroll tasks and reduce manual workload.
Key Functions of Payroll Software
Payroll software typically includes a range of features to support various payroll-related activities. The most common functions include:
-
Wage Calculation: Automatically calculates employee salaries based on hours worked, pay rates, overtime, bonuses, and commissions.
-
Tax Deductions: Calculates income tax, social security, retirement contributions, and other statutory deductions.
-
Payslip Generation: Produces digital or printable payslips for employees.
-
Direct Deposits: Transfers wages directly to employees’ bank accounts.
-
Compliance Management: Ensures payroll is aligned with local labor laws and tax regulations.
-
Reporting: Generates reports on payroll summaries, tax filings, and employee compensation.
-
Record Keeping: Stores payroll data securely for auditing and future reference.
How Does Payroll Software Work?
While features may vary by platform, the basic operation of payroll software generally follows these steps:
1. Employee Data Entry
To begin, user details such as employee names, job titles, pay rates, work hours, tax status, and benefits are entered into the system.
2. Time Tracking Integration
The software can be integrated with time-tracking tools or attendance systems to automatically calculate the hours worked, sick days, and overtime.
3. Payroll Calculation
Based on the data entered and hours tracked, the software calculates each employee’s gross pay, deductions, and net pay.
4. Payment Processing
Payroll software can initiate direct bank deposits or generate payment files for manual transfers. Some solutions also offer integration with third-party payment processors.
5. Payslip Distribution
The system generates payslips and delivers them to employees through email, employee portals, or printed copies.
6. Tax Filing and Compliance
Payroll software helps file required tax documents and ensures the business stays compliant with all legal regulations, including tax submissions and reporting.
Benefits of Using Payroll Software
Time-Saving
Automating payroll reduces the time spent on manual calculations, paperwork, and tax filings.
Accuracy
It minimizes human errors in calculations, reducing issues such as underpayments or incorrect tax deductions.
Cost-Effective
For small businesses, using payroll software can be more affordable than outsourcing payroll to an external provider.
Scalability
Payroll software can grow with your business, adapting to new hires, different pay structures, and complex compliance requirements.
Data Security
Reputable payroll systems store sensitive employee information securely and ensure compliance with data protection regulations.
Who Should Use Payroll Software?
Payroll software is suitable for:
-
Small business owners who want to manage payroll in-house with minimal effort.
-
HR professionals looking for efficient tools to handle compensation and compliance.
-
Accountants or finance teams needing accurate records and reports.
-
Startups and growing companies aiming to scale without increasing manual admin work.
Conclusion
Payroll software is an essential tool for businesses that want to streamline the payroll process, ensure compliance, and save valuable time and resources. By automating routine tasks and reducing the risk of errors, it allows business owners and HR professionals to focus more on strategic priorities.
Whether you’re running payroll for a handful of employees or a growing team, investing in the right payroll software can improve efficiency, boost accuracy, and keep your business on track.

Comments
0 comment